Q2 2023 Top Tabletop Board Games on Android in the US: A Sensor Tower Analysis

The second quarter of 2023 has been bustling with activity in the digital board game arena. Based on the latest data from Sensor Tower, let's delve into the performance of the top 5 tabletop board game applications on Android within the United States.

YAHTZEE With Buddies Dice Game by Scopely has shown consistent revenue, maintaining around $300k to $320k weekly, with a slight dip towards the end of the quarter. Downloads for the game began at around 18k and saw a peak of over 21k towards the end of May. Weekly active users started at around 220k and fluctuated slightly, ending the quarter with about 222k active users.

Chess enthusiasts have been engaging with Chess - Play and Learn by Chess.com, which saw revenues fluctuating between $70k and $86k weekly. The app experienced a significant spike in downloads in early April with over 80k downloads, but later settled to around 22k by the end of June. Active users showed a declining trend from over 1 million at the start of the quarter to approximately 829k by the end of June.

Yalla Ludo - Ludo&Domino by Aviva Sun initially saw revenues of around $138k, with a noticeable decline to just over $24k by the quarter's end. The app's downloads had an upward trend in early May, peaking at nearly 10k before dropping to around 5k. Weekly active users started strong at around 116k but dipped to just over 121k by the end of Q2.

Beach Bum Ltd.'s Backgammon - Lord of the Board experienced a steady revenue stream, starting at $73k and ending the quarter on a high note with over $68k. Downloads remained relatively low but consistent, ranging from 910 to just over 1.3k. Active users showed a slight increase from approximately 18k to 19k throughout the quarter.

Lastly, Dice With Buddies™ Social Game, also from Scopely, maintained a revenue between $47k and $59k. Downloads peaked at nearly 3k in early May and ended the quarter with around 2.6k. Active users saw a rise from around 19k to nearly 19k by the end of June.
